随着现代生活节奏的加快,越来越多的家庭开始寻求家政服务来分担家务负担。为了满足这一市场需求,开发一款高效、便捷的家政上门服务系统APP显得尤为重要。本文将详细介绍如何从零开始搭建家政上门服务系统APP的源码,包括技术选型、功能设计、数据库架构以及安全措施等方面的内容。
一、技术选型在家政上门服务系统APP的开发中,我们选择了当前流行的React Native框架进行移动端开发,后端则采用了Node.js和Express框架。这种技术组合不仅能够提供跨平台的应用支持,还具备高效的开发效率和良好的性能表现。
二、功能设计用户注册与登录:用户可以通过手机号或邮箱进行注册,并设置密码登录。为了提高用户体验,还可以集成第三方登录(如微信、QQ等)。
服务浏览与预约:用户可以在APP上浏览各种家政服务(如保洁、月嫂、育儿嫂等),并选择合适的服务进行预约。预约时需要填写服务时间、地址等信息。
服务评价与反馈:用户可以对已完成的服务进行评价和反馈,帮助其他用户做出更好的选择。
订单管理:用户可以查看自己的订单状态(待支付、待服务、已完成等),并对订单进行管理(如取消、修改等)。
个人中心:用户可以在个人中心查看和管理自己的个人信息、优惠券、积分等。
在家政上门服务系统APP中,我们需要设计合理的数据库架构来存储用户信息、服务信息、订单信息等数据。通常,我们会使用关系型数据库(如MySQL)来进行数据存储。下面是一个简单的数据库架构示例:
用户表:存储用户的基本信息(如ID、姓名、手机号、邮箱等)。
服务表:存储家政服务的基本信息(如ID、服务名称、价格、描述等)。
订单表:存储订单的基本信息(如ID、用户ID、服务ID、预约时间、地址、状态等)。
评价表:存储用户对服务的评价和反馈信息。
为了保障用户数据的安全和隐私,我们需要在家政上门服务系统APP中采取一系列安全措施:
数据加密:对敏感数据(如密码)进行加密存储,防止数据泄露。
权限控制:对不同角色的用户进行权限控制,确保用户只能访问和操作自己有权限的数据。
输入验证:对用户输入的数据进行严格验证,防止SQL注入等攻击。
安全审计:记录用户的操作日志,以便在发生安全问题时进行追踪和分析。
通过以上步骤,我们可以搭建一个功能齐全、安全可靠的家政上门服务系统APP。当然,这只是一个基础版本,实际应用中还需要根据具体需求进行更多的功能扩展和优化。希望本文能为您在家政上门服务系统APP的开发过程中提供一些有益的参考和启示。
- 语音社交聊天交友系统开发外包成熟案例 2024-11-13
- 成人用品商城APP开发平台搭建外包服务商 2024-11-13
- 成人商城软件开发app、公众号、小程序搭建 2024-11-13
- 本地生活系统开发APP软件系统开发成品案例 2024-11-13
- 陪玩陪聊天软件外包软件开发源码出售 2024-11-13
- 广告联盟对接短剧变现APP开发简介原生开发 2024-11-13
- 国际商城跨境电商APP源码开发方案模板 2024-11-13
- 区域分红商城APP开发代理分红商城平台搭建 2024-11-13
- shechi品租赁平台系统开发公司源码交付 2024-11-13
- 圈子社交软件开发同城交友线下约玩源码交付 2024-11-13
- 同城行业分类信息发布平台APP开发搭建源码出售 2024-11-13
- 陪玩接单平台游戏陪玩app开发软件现成源码 2024-11-13
- 语音聊天APP视频交友礼物打赏APP开发方案方案模板 2024-11-13
- 智能无人棋牌室APP系统开发外包服务商 2024-11-13
- 霸王餐软件系统APP开发成熟案例 2024-11-13